Taxonomic Classification

Rank Brook Floater Clouded Apollo
Kingdom same Animalia (동물) Animalia (동물)
Phylum Mollusca (연체동물) Arthropoda (절지동물)
Class Bivalvia (이매패류) Insecta (곤충)
Order Unionida (석패목) Lepidoptera (나비목)
Family Unionidae Papilionidae
Genus Alasmidonta Parnassius
Species Alasmidonta varicosa Parnassius mnemosyne
